- The distance between Wonsan, South Korea and Libby, Mt, Usa is approximately 8,473 km or 5,265 mi.
- To reach Wonsan in this distance one would set out from Libby, Mt bearing 314.7°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Wonsan bearing 217.5° or SW .
- Wonsan has a hot summer continental climate with dry winters (Dwa) whereas Libby, Mt has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Wonsan is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Libby, Mt is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 2.5 °C (4.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.3 °C (5.9°F) more in Wonsan.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 937.7 mm (36.9 in) more which is equivalent to 937.7 l/m² (23.01 US gal/ft²) or 9,377,000 l/ha (1,002,464 US gal/ac) more. About 3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.2° higher in Wonsan than in Libby, Mt.
